Can I add 3rd party plug-ins to acrobat pro dc?

Yes, if they were designed to work with Acrobat Pro DC.

Plug-ins designed for earlier versions of Acrobat Pro on MacOS will not work with the current version given the transition from 32-bit to 64-bit operation.

For plug-ins designed for earlier versions of Acrobat Pro on Windows, ascertain from the plug-in vendor whether the current version is Acrobat Pro DC-compatible. Some are, some aren't!

Can you help me figure out how to install them?

Most third party plug-ins come with either installers or instructions on how to install them. Since each plug-in is different and may have dependencies on multiple files being placed in various directories in your system (plus, on Windows, perhaps some registry entries), you need to reach out to whoever develops / markets / supports the plug-in in question for such installation instructions that are appropriate.
